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Reigate to Stow start from as little as £58.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Reigate to Stow start from £102.10 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Reigate to Stow are available for £210.30 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Reigate Station

Reigate Station offers a wide range of amenities designed to make your journey comfortable. The ticket office is open from Monday to Friday, between 06:10 and 12:45, and on Saturdays from 07:10 to 13:45, making it convenient for early risers. Ticket machines are available and accessible, securing your travel plans without the queues. If an online purchase is more your style, tickets can easily be collected at the station.

Comprehensive assistance services are at the heart of Reigate Station. The team is ready to help from the early morning hours, and help points are present across platforms to ensure passengers with diverse needs are catered to effectively. Accessibility options include step-free access, induction loops for the hearing-impaired, and staff-operated ramps that aid easy boarding. There's also CCTV coverage for enhanced safety.

Though the station lacks food and drink facilities in-house, a nearby newsagent is perfect for a quick grab-and-go snack. Also, while there isn't a waiting room, there are seating areas provided and toilets available on Platform 1.

Transport Links and Connectivity

Reigate Station is well-connected with different modes of transport, creating a seamless start or end to your travel journey. Taxi services can be booked right outside the main entrance, and those preferring buses can rely on the auxiliary maps for planning onward journeys. Parking is accessible throughout the week, with 58 spots ready for travelers driving to the station.

Accessibility travel facilities at Reigate Station ensure everyone can travel safely. Rail replacement services keep unpredictability at bay, ensuring that connectivity is maintained even in the face of service disruptions. There’s cycling storage available which mirrors the station's commitment to sustainable transport options.

Facilities and Amenities

While Stow Station may not boast an array of luxurious amenities, it provides the key essentials for a smooth travel experience. Travellers can purchase tickets conveniently at one of the accessible ticket machines located on Platform 1. Although there isn't a ticket office, these machines do accept tickets collected from online services. Moreover, smartcard validators are present for those holding electronic travel cards.

Accessibility is a priority at Stow with step-free access throughout, ideal for those with mobility needs or heavy luggage. The Category A station ensures ease of movement from parking to platform, with dedicated Blue Badge parking bays available. However, facilities such as accessible toilets and staffed help points are not available, so it's recommended to plan accordingly.

Onward Travel Options

Upon arrival at Stow, travellers have multiple options for continuing their journey. For those relying on public transport, buses regularly stop at junctions on the A7, just a short stroll from the station, offering convenient routes to destinations like Tweedbank and Edinburgh. For further details on bus services, the Traveline Scotland website and customer service are available. Parking and Cycling Facilities

Those driving to the station will find ample parking managed by ScotRail, with 33 spaces available at no extra charge. Cyclists are also catered for, with 20 bicycle storage spaces that are sheltered and secure under CCTV surveillance.
